Effects of breeds, tissues and genders on purine contents in pork and the relationships between purine content and other meat quality traits

The purine contents of animal foods are becoming widely concerned because excess intake of purine increases the risk of hyperuricemia and gout. In this study, we investigated the impacts of breed, tissue and sex on pork purine content and its correlations with multiple meat quality traits. Among six pig breeds, the average value of total purine contents (TP) in longissimus lumborum muscle was lowest in Chinese Laiwu pigs (114.2 mg/100 g) while highest in Chinese Bamaxiang mini pigs (139.3 mg/100 g). Considerable variations in TP were observed within most breeds, as well as among twelve pork organs with the range from 7 to 245 mg/100 g. However, no significant differences in TP were found between barrows and gilts. Intriguingly, lower purine content in meat was significantly associated with higher ultimate pH, better meat color and more abundant intramuscular fat content and marbling. The results thus suggest that the selection of low-purine pig species is available, which may simultaneously improve other meat quality traits.
